Munshiganj: Rapid Action Battalion (RAB) has apprehended a fugitive accused in the murder case of Shahid Abdul Kaiyum, a 25-year-old university student, who was killed during an anti-discrimination student movement in Sirajdikhan upazila. The arrest took place on Wednesday.

According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, the arrested individual has been identified as Md. Amir Hossen, 40, the son of the late Ahed Ali from Bederpara Boktapur area under Savar Police Station. The arrest was made at 3 pm when a RAB-10 team conducted a raid in the land office area of Sirajdikhan upazila, as per an official release from RAB-10.

The incident traces back to August 5 of the previous year when Abdul Kaiyum was shot on the Dhaka-Aricha Highway amid an anti-discrimination student protest, as mentioned in the release. Following the shooting, Kaiyum was rushed to Enam Medical College Hospital, where he was pronounced dead by medical professionals.

In the aftermath of the incident, a case was filed by the victim's mother at Savar Model Police Station. RAB sources confirmed that the accused, Md. Amir Hossen, has been handed over to Savar Model Police Station for further legal proceedings.
